如何使用iis创建一个web

如何使用iis创建一个web

如何使用IIS创建一个Web

使用IIS创建一个Web站点的基本步骤包括:安装IIS、配置站点、添加内容、配置安全设置、测试和调试。 其中,安装IIS是最重要的一步,因为它是整个过程的基础。下面详细描述如何完成这一步。

一、安装IIS

IIS(Internet Information Services)是微软提供的Web服务器软件,它可以通过Windows的“添加或删除程序”功能来安装。以下是具体步骤:

  1. 访问“添加或删除程序”:

    • 打开控制面板,选择“程序和功能”,然后点击“启用或关闭Windows功能”。
    • 在弹出的窗口中,找到“IIS(Internet Information Services)”,然后勾选它。
  2. 选择需要的IIS组件:

    • 在选择IIS组件时,可以根据需求勾选不同的功能组件,如Web管理工具、FTP服务器等。
    • 常用的组件包括:IIS管理控制台、IIS管理脚本和工具、World Wide Web 服务。
    • 点击确定,系统会自动开始安装并配置IIS组件。
  3. 验证安装:

二、配置站点

配置站点是确保Web站点能够正确运行的关键步骤。以下是配置站点的详细步骤:

  1. 打开IIS管理器:

    • 通过开始菜单,找到IIS管理器并打开。
    • 在左侧的连接面板中,展开服务器节点,右键点击“站点”,选择“添加网站”。
  2. 添加新网站:

    • 在弹出的“添加网站”窗口中,输入站点名称、物理路径和绑定信息。
    • 站点名称可以随意输入,但物理路径必须是存放网站文件的实际路径。
    • 绑定信息包括IP地址、端口和主机名,一般默认即可。
  3. 配置站点属性:

    • 在“基本设置”窗口中,可以进一步配置站点的应用程序池、物理路径凭据等。
    • 应用程序池用于管理网站的应用程序,确保它们在独立的进程中运行,提高安全性和稳定性。

三、添加内容

添加内容是让Web站点展示信息的关键步骤。以下是添加内容的详细步骤:

  1. 创建网站文件:

    • 在物理路径下创建网站的HTML、CSS、JavaScript等文件。
    • 确保文件结构清晰,有利于后续的维护和更新。
  2. 上传文件到服务器:

    • 如果是本地开发,可以直接将文件复制到物理路径下。
    • 如果是远程服务器,可以通过FTP、SFTP等方式上传文件。
  3. 配置默认文档:

    • 在IIS管理器中,选择站点,点击“默认文档”。
    • 添加或修改默认文档,如index.html、default.aspx等。

四、配置安全设置

配置安全设置是保障Web站点安全的重要步骤。以下是配置安全设置的详细步骤:

  1. 设置文件权限:

    • 在物理路径下,右键点击文件夹,选择“属性”,然后点击“安全”选项卡。
    • 添加或修改用户权限,确保只有必要的用户可以访问和修改文件。
  2. 配置SSL证书:

    • 在IIS管理器中,选择站点,点击“绑定”。
    • 添加HTTPS绑定,并选择或导入SSL证书。
    • 配置完成后,通过https://站点地址访问网站,确保数据传输加密。
  3. 配置防火墙:

    • 在服务器上配置防火墙规则,允许必要的端口(如80、443)通过,阻止其他不必要的端口。

五、测试和调试

测试和调试是确保Web站点正常运行的重要步骤。以下是测试和调试的详细步骤:

  1. 测试站点访问:

    • 通过浏览器访问站点地址,确保页面能够正常加载。
    • 检查页面中的链接、图片、脚本等是否正常工作。
  2. 调试错误:

    • 如果遇到页面加载错误,可以通过浏览器的开发者工具查看错误信息。
    • 在IIS管理器中,可以查看日志文件,分析错误原因。
  3. 性能测试:

    • 使用性能测试工具,如LoadRunner、JMeter等,模拟多用户访问,测试站点的性能和稳定性。
    • 根据测试结果,优化站点的代码和配置,提高性能。

六、优化和维护

优化和维护是确保Web站点长期稳定运行的重要步骤。以下是优化和维护的详细步骤:

  1. 优化代码:

    • 优化HTML、CSS、JavaScript代码,减少页面加载时间。
    • 使用压缩工具,如Gzip,压缩站点文件。
  2. 定期备份:

    • 定期备份网站文件和数据库,防止数据丢失。
    • 可以使用自动备份工具,如BackupBuddy,定期备份网站。
  3. 更新和维护:

    • 定期更新网站内容,保持网站的新鲜度。
    • 及时修复网站中的安全漏洞,确保网站安全。

七、使用项目管理系统

在管理和维护Web站点的过程中,可以使用项目管理系统来提高工作效率。推荐使用以下两个系统:

  1. 研发项目管理系统PingCode

    • PingCode专为研发团队设计,提供强大的项目管理和协作功能。
    • 可以通过PingCode管理开发任务、跟踪Bug、协作开发,提高团队效率。
  2. 通用项目协作软件Worktile

    • Worktile适用于各类项目管理,提供任务管理、时间管理、团队协作等功能。
    • 可以通过Worktile管理网站的更新和维护任务,确保工作有序进行。

通过以上步骤,您可以成功地使用IIS创建一个Web站点,并确保其安全、稳定和高效运行。希望本文对您有所帮助!

相关问答FAQs:

1. 如何在IIS中创建一个Web应用程序?
在IIS中创建一个Web应用程序非常简单。首先,打开IIS管理器。然后,右键点击“站点”并选择“添加网站”。接下来,您需要填写网站的名称、物理路径和端口号。点击“确定”后,您的网站就创建成功了。

2. 如何将Web应用程序部署到IIS上?
要将Web应用程序部署到IIS上,首先确保您的应用程序已经编译成功。然后,将编译好的应用程序文件复制到IIS的网站物理路径下。接下来,在IIS管理器中找到您的网站,右键点击并选择“添加应用程序”。填写应用程序的别名和物理路径,然后点击“确定”。现在,您的Web应用程序已经成功部署到IIS上了。

3. 如何配置IIS以在Web应用程序中使用特定的端口号?
如果您想在Web应用程序中使用特定的端口号,可以在IIS管理器中对网站进行配置。首先,找到您的网站,右键点击并选择“编辑绑定”。在弹出的窗口中,您可以添加或编辑绑定。在绑定的“类型”中选择“http”,然后在“IP地址”中选择“所有未分配的”。在“端口”中填写您想要使用的特定端口号。点击“确定”后,您的Web应用程序将会使用您配置的端口号进行访问。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2953275

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部